Ingredients
In a small ziploc bag or baby food container, mix:
- 1/4 cup oatmeal
- 1/4 cup sugar
- sprinkle of red or green sugar crystals (for cookie decorating)
This also makes a great gift. You can create tags and add them to the bags when gifting.
I created the tags on picmonkey. The poem on the tag says
Magic Reindeer Food
Sprinkle on the lawn at night
The moon will make it sparkle bright
Santa’s reindeer will fly and roam
This will help them find your home
